When It’s Time to Get Your Air Conditioner Repaired

Is the level of comfort in your home disappointing what you would like it to be? There are other, more subtle problems that, if disregarded, might lead to more serious repairs or the requirement for an early replacement of your a/c unit. While a system that will not turn on is a clear indication that you require repairs, there are other, less obvious problems. If you recognize with the more subtle indicators of a problem with your a/c, you will be able to call a expert service professional earlier rather than later.

If any of the following apply, one of our Missouri AC repair experts advises that you give us a call:

  • You are incurring an increase in the amount of money needed to spend for your month-to-month utility expenses: Inefficient operation of your air conditioning system can be caused by a number of different issues, including dripping ductwork, an internal malfunction, or a faulty thermostat. This means that it needs to work harder to keep your property cool, which will lead to a considerable boost in the amount that you pay in utility costs.
  • You only observe hot air coming out of your vents: First things first, make sure you haven’t inadvertently set the thermostat to the inaccurate temperature level by checking it. If that is not the case, then you probably have a issue on the inside of your a/c unit, and you ought to get it checked by a professional.
  • You are seeing a higher humidity level at your property: Even though this is not the main function of your a/c, it is accountable for managing the humidity level inside of your home or business structure. Greater humidity suggests that there is an excess of wetness in the air, which can result in the development of mold and mildew in addition to making the air feel warm and sticky. It is vital that you get this matter dealt with as quickly as humanly possible, especially for the sake of your safety.
  • The air flow in your system is inadequate: Regrettably, there are a wide range of aspects that can result in insufficient air flow. We will need to carry out a detailed evaluation in order to figure out whether the problem is the result of a blocked air filter, an issue with the blower, frozen evaporator coils, leaking ductwork, or obstructed duct.
  • You observe that there is a considerable amount of moisture in the location around your system: Condensation is a natural occurrence, nevertheless it should not be present in extreme amounts. It is possible that you have a leaking refrigerant or a clogged up drain tube if you discover any excess moisture or pooling water in the area.
  • Unusual Noises from Your Unit: It is to be expected for an ac system to develop some background sound while it is running. On the other hand, if it begins making audible shrieking, screeching, grinding, groaning, or scraping sounds, this is an apparent indicator that something needs to be fixed.
  • It appears that there is a issue with your thermostat: It’s possible that the thermostat is the source of the problems you’re having with your a/c unit. If you have hot and cold areas around your home, your system won’t turn off, or it will not begin, it could be because of a problem with the thermostat. If your unit will not begin, it might also be because it will not shut down.
  • Foul odors are coming from your unit: There may be a issue with your air conditioner if you smell anything burning or a musty odor. These odors can be caused by a variety of factors, consisting of mold development and charred wiring.
  • Your unit rotates typically between the following states: When the temperature level inside your home reaches the level that you have actually selected on the thermostat, air conditioning unit are programmed to switch off automatically. In spite of this, it will continue to cycle even when there is something wrong with it.

The HVAC System Is Making Weird Noises

There are a few sounds that should not be heard originating from air conditioners even though they do not operate in full silence. These noises might be anything from a banging to a shrieking to a grinding to a clicking sound. These specific sounds almost always indicate that there is a problem within the a/c unit that has to be fixed by a expert of in Cass County.

Sounds that are Weird and Different Coming From Your air conditioner The following need to be consisted of:

  • Banging: The issue is generally the compressor in an ac system that is making a banging noise. This element of the a/c unit is responsible for providing refrigerant to the numerous other components of the unit in order to remove excess heat from your home. Compressor parts might chill out as the air conditioner system ages. This sound is caused by the parts moving and rattling and crashing one another.
  • Screeching: A broken blower fan motor within the air conditioner may produce a sound comparable to shrieking or squealing if the motor is working incorrectly. Normally, a defective fan belt or broken bearings in the motor are to blame for this sound. Shut off the air conditioner immediately and contact a professional for repairs whenever you hear a shrieking noise.
  • Grinding: The sound of something grinding is never ever a excellent indication to hear originating from any sort of mechanical item. Pistons inside the compressor may have worn, which might result in this grinding noise emanating from the a/c. When a compressor’s pistons become worn, it generally shows that the compressor itself needs to be changed. The total air conditioner unit might need to be changed depending upon the design of air conditioning and how old it is.
  • Clicking: It is really normal for an air conditioning system to make a clicking noise when it at first turns on. If you hear clicking throughout the entire period of the cooling cycle, then there is a issue with the clicking. These clicks are the result of a thermostat that is not working effectively.
